Part-time jobs in London, Ontario, offer a great opportunity for students and workers to earn extra income while gaining valuable work experience. The city's diverse economy and large student population create a variety of part-time job options across various sectors.
Popular Part-Time Jobs for Students and Workers in London, Ontario:
- Retail and Customer Service: Many retail stores, cafes, and restaurants in London hire part-time staff, especially during peak seasons.
- Food Service: Working as a server, cashier, or kitchen staff in local eateries is a common part-time job for students.
- Tutoring and Teaching: Students with strong academic skills can find part-time tutoring or teaching jobs at learning centers or private homes.
- Warehouse and Logistics: Warehouses and distribution centers often hire part-time workers for tasks like packing, shipping, and receiving.
- Healthcare: Hospitals, clinics, and long-term care facilities may have part-time positions for healthcare assistants, support workers, or administrative staff.
- Call Centers: Many call centers in London hire part-time customer service representatives.
- Delivery Driver: Food delivery services and courier companies often hire part-time delivery drivers.
- Campus Jobs: Universities and colleges in London offer part-time jobs on campus, such as library assistants, lab technicians, or administrative roles.
Where to Find Part-Time Jobs in London:
- Online Job Boards: Websites like Indeed, LinkedIn, and Kijiji are excellent resources for finding part-time job listings.
- University and College Career Centers: These centers often have job boards and resources specifically for students.
- Local Businesses: Directly approaching local businesses and inquiring about part-time job opportunities can be effective.
- Temporary Agencies: Temporary agencies can connect you with part-time jobs in various industries.
Tips for Finding a Part-Time Job in London:
- Start Early: Begin your job search well in advance, especially if you're targeting specific industries or companies.
- Network: Connect with friends, classmates, and alumni who may know about job openings.
- Update Your Resume and Cover Letter: Tailor your resume and cover letter to each job application.
- Practice Interview Skills: Prepare for common interview questions and practice your answers.
- Be Flexible: Be open to different shifts and job types to increase your chances of finding a suitable position.
